Agentic AI security favors attackers over defenders, reshaping vendor competition

Illustration accompanying: Autonomy and Innovation

Stratechery's analysis surfaces a structural asymmetry in agentic AI security: offensive capabilities scale faster than defensive ones, creating persistent advantage for attackers and new entrants over established players. This dynamic mirrors historical patterns in cybersecurity but applies specifically to autonomous systems, where the cost of deploying novel attack vectors remains lower than building comprehensive defenses. The implication reshapes competitive positioning: startups building specialized agentic security tools face fewer moats than traditional enterprise security vendors, while incumbents struggle to retrofit defensive postures into systems designed for speed and autonomy rather than containment.

Analyst take

The real insight isn't that offense beats defense (that's old news in security). It's that agentic systems compress the feedback loop: attackers can probe, adapt, and redeploy faster than defenders can patch autonomous behavior. This inverts the traditional enterprise security playbook where scale and resources favored incumbents.

If a startup shipping specialized agentic security tooling (prompt injection detection, behavior containment, output filtering) gains adoption faster at major cloud providers than those providers' internal security teams can build equivalent features, that confirms the structural advantage. Watch whether OpenAI, Google, or Anthropic acquire or deeply integrate a third-party agentic security vendor within the next 12 months as a signal they've conceded the moat question.
